“He who separates himself seeks his own desire, he quarrels against all sound wisdom.  A fool does not delight in understanding, but only in revealing his own mind.  When a wicked man comes, contempt also comes, and with dishonour comes scorn.

 

“The words of a man’s mouth are deep waters; the fountain of wisdom is a bubbling brook.  To show partiality to the wicked is not good, nor to thrust aside the righteous in judgment.  A fool’s lips bring strife, and his mouth calls for blows.  A fools’ mouth is his ruin, and his lips are the snare of his soul. 

 

“The words of a whisperer are like dainty morsel, and they go down into the innermost parts of the body.  He also who is slack in his work is brother to him who destroys.  The name of the Lord is a strong tower; the righteous runs into it and is safe.  Proverbs 18:1-10

 

“So also the tongue is a small part of the body, and yet it boasts of great things.  See how great a forest is set aflame by such a small fire!  And the tongue is a fire, the very world of iniquity; the tongue is set among our members as that which de3files the entire body, and sets on fire the course of our life, and is set on fire by hell.” James 3:5-6

 

I don’t know about you, but there are times when running into the pages of Scripture is all that can quiet my heart.  As you consider these verses, they are offered to remind you of how your words can trip you up and how your loving Heavenly Father is always waiting for you to return to His righteousness.  It is only there where there is safety and compassion.
